A Tale of Weight Loss and Gain

This Reddit user lost a whopping 70 pounds over the course of 18 months, going from 175 pounds down to 105 pounds. However, they don’t stop there. After achieving their weight loss goals, they’ve since gained back up to 135 pounds with the help of weight training.

The Struggles Along the Way

Along their weight loss journey, the user didn’t find a single “miracle” solution. Instead, they experimented with different diets and exercise routines until they found what worked best for them. They didn’t deprive themselves of foods they loved, but instead tried to eat in moderation.

The Importance of Patience

This Reddit user’s weight loss journey didn’t happen overnight. They stressed the importance of being patient with yourself and allowing mistakes to happen. At times, they gained weight or had difficulty breaking a plateau. But ultimately, with consistency and effort, they were able to reach their goals.

Tips for Your Own Journey

While everyone’s weight loss journey is unique, there are some tips that can help anyone on their path. First, don’t be too hard on yourself if you make mistakes. Second, try to find an exercise routine and diet that you enjoy and can stick to. Third, consider incorporating weight training into your routine to help build muscle and boost metabolism.
